Applied Biologics: 4 sponsored US clinical trials, 4 recruiting.

Applied Biologics sponsors 4 registered US clinical trials on ClinicalTrials.gov, 4 of them currently recruiting. 2 of these trials are in Phase 3-4 (later-stage) and 0 in Phase 1-2 (earlier-stage). The most-studied condition in this pipeline is Diabetic Foot Ulcer, with 3 trials.

How open-pipeline share is computed

Recruiting share is recruiting_count divided by trial_count for this sponsor in the public registry export. Status can change between pulls; treat the figure as a research-attention snapshot, not product availability.
